Lunar New Year

Lunar New Year is a celebration observed by many cultures across East and Southeast Asia, marking the beginning of the lunar calendar. The holiday begins with the first new moon of the lunar calendar and concludes 15 days later on the first full moon. It’s a time to honor cultural heritage, welcome new beginnings, and reflect on traditions passed down through generations.
